When DC released the product information for its first run of New 52 hardcover collections it was revealed that DC co-publisher Dan Didio and legendary artist Jerry Ordway would be working on a short three issue arc for the company’s new anthology title, DC Universe Presents following the initial Deadman arc by Paul Jenkins and Bernard Chang. What was unclear until now was the property this new dynamic duo would be tackling. As it turns out, they will be updating and modernizing the classic Jack Kirby property The Challengers of the Unknown. After being major players in the DCU in the 70s and being later redefined by Jeph Loeb and Tim Sale in one of their earliest partnerships, not much has been done with the property in quite a while.

It’s also worth noting that this will be the second Jack Kirby property that Didio will be writing in the DCnU, following his and Keith Giffen’s update of Kirby classic OMAC. With Darkseid and the New Gods mythology also having its own comeback in Justice League, it’s clear that DC will not be letting the legacy of The King go untapped moving forward.

Stay tuned for this sucker to drop in February in DCU Presents #6.
